Greater Burlington is rich in history and full of exciting attractions such as the PZAZZ! Entertainment Complex, minor league baseball, and Starr's Cave Park. Known for Snake Alley, "The Crookedest Street in the World," Burlington delights all with many attractions, a lot of history, and a little magic. The unit is located one block from the Mississippi River. Walking distance to several restaurants and pubs. Iowa welcome center is in the Port of Burlington on the river just east of the unit.
